在 PENTAHO 中生成一系列查询
Posted
技术标签:
【中文标题】在 PENTAHO 中生成一系列查询【英文标题】:Generate serie of queries in PENTAHO 【发布时间】:2020-06-12 21:11:39 【问题描述】:如何基于表列表构建通用查询并运行/导出结果?
这是我的概念结构
conceptual structure
基本上,查询中的 from 子句将由表行插入。 之后,每个返回结果为 true 的 schema.table 都必须存储在文本存档中。
有人可以帮我吗?
【问题讨论】:
我认为您应该通过以下步骤解决您的任务:执行 SQL 脚本、动态 SQL 行或执行行 SQL 脚本。 【参考方案1】:由于 pentaho 不支持循环,所以有点复杂。基本上,您读取表列表并将行复制到结果中,然后您有一个 foreach-job 为结果中的每一行运行。
我将此设置用于所有这样的工作:How to process a Kettle transformation once per filename
在链接的示例中,它用于处理文件,但它可以很容易地适应您的使用。
【讨论】:
以上是关于在 PENTAHO 中生成一系列查询的主要内容,如果未能解决你的问题,请参考以下文章
在 Pentaho 数据集成中将字段从 String 更改为 Int
应用Pentaho Data Integration(Kettle) 6.1 进行数据抽取以及指标计算(同构数据抽取)